Job Description: Recovery Coach
Time commitment: 40 hours a week
Reports to: Anthem House Director
Status: Full-Time; At-Will Employee
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Take students to weekly recovery groups in the community
- Create individualized treatment plans for boys in recovery
- Coach students and hold them accountable on actualizing plans
- Assist in staffing shifts, helping things go right each weeknight
- Use the Pyramid of Influence in helping students recover
- Gives oversight to drug tests
- Proactively teach students principles of recovery
- Work with the students on their dailies
- Report in treatment team weekly
- Respond to parent questions as needed
- Plan and execute weekly fun and recovery activities
- Enforcing student rules
- Monitoring and carrying out consequences under the direction of the shift supervisor
- Charting in each student's medical record on the HQ database
- Communicating and reporting to shift supervisor
- Supporting and assisting other Telos departments in their job descriptions (i.e.: nursing appointments, education testing, grading, tutoring, general cleaning and maintenance, answering telephones, shopping, transporting) as allowed by staffing ratios
- Participating on assigned committees or special assignments
- Assisting with runaway retrieval
- Participating in therapeutic holds and restraints
- Attending and maintaining current certifications such as CPR and first aid
Qualifications:
- Experience working with adolescent boys with emotional disorders
- Experience working with SU disorders
- Experience with mindfulness skills
- Experience with the 12-step model of recovery and other researched based models of recovery
- Inspiring interpersonal skills
- Organized
- Excellent verbal skills
- Excellent written skills
- Exceptional relationship skills
- Timely
- Dependable and reliable
- Ability to hold appropriate boundaries
- Ability to receive and carry out instruction
- Genuine care and concern for others
